ZnS-ZnFe2O4: Magnetic nanocatalyst for efficient synthesis of tetrasubstituted benzimidazoles
Catalysts in chemical reactions improve the reaction conditions, increase the speed and yield of the products. So, they play a prominent role in various industries such as the chemical industry, petroleum industry, and pharmaceutical chemistry. In this work, an efficient and co-friendly method for the synthesis of 1,2,4,5-tetrasubstituted imidazoles via a four-component condensation of benzil, aldehydes, primary amines and ammonium acetate in the presence of a magnetic nanocatalyst, ZnS-ZnFe2O4, in ethanol under refluxing conditions is presented. Magnetic ZnS-ZnFe2O4 was prepared via a simple method and characterized by energy-dispersive X-ray analysis (EDAX), field-emission scanning electron microscopy (FESEM), X-Ray diffraction pattern (XRD) and vibrating sample magnetometer (VSM). This protocol has advantages such as high yields of the products, use of a green solvent, simple and chromatography-free work-up procedure. Most importantly, the catalyst can be conveniently recovered from the reaction mixture by using external magnet and reused for at least three times without significant decrease in catalytic activity.
